Admiral William Marrack, Royal Navy, Retired (18 February, 1847 – 23 January, 1926) was an officer of the Royal Navy.

Early Life & Career

Marrack was promoted to the rank of Commander on 30 June, 1882.[1]

Marrack was promoted to the rank of Rear-Admiral on 24 January, 1902, vice Jackson.[2] He was promoted to the rank of Vice-Admiral on 11 November, 1906, vice Beresford.[3]

He was placed on the Retired List at his own request on 17 November, 1906.[4]

Marrack died at Plymouth on 23 January, 1926.[5]
